What are Index Nodes?

Index Nodes form a network of loosely connected, highly aligned physical spaces for gathering across the world. Though they may differ in use, all Nodes exist in service of their members in a transparent and non-extractive way. Locally-minded but globally aware, every Node is made by those who use it, and helps to broaden the network’s planetary community of communities.

How do I open an Index Node?

Index offers a grant to empower people in local communities to serve those communities better through physical space. Anyone, anywhere, can apply to open one. The existing space operators and extended community of current Nodes will vote democratically on who receives the grant.

The first grant round will soon open and award a ~$20,000 starters fund (more info) by the end of Q1 2024.

What do Nodes have in common?

Every Node shares the same set of core values, while having the freedom to bring them to life in their own ways →

For members, by members: Members of Nodes always have, at minimum, a say about how the space evolves.

Non-extractive: Our members are never a product, nor user: they’re members.

Transparent: Finances, use of membership fees and other decisions that impacts members are openly communicated.

Space as infrastructure for community: A Node’s core use-case answers a local need while staying open to additional uses as well.

Public: Every Node has some sort of connection to the public that leaves the door open for non-members to engage.

Free benefit to members of other Nodes: Most common is that Nodes extend some form of temporary-membership / visitation rights to each other (i.e. working from Index when visiting New York).

Shared Code of Conduct: All Nodes share and adhere to the Garden3D CoC.

Referential to Index Space, LLC: All nodes are required to reference @index_space in their social media bios, link back to [<https://www.index-space.org>](<https://www.index-space.org>) on their websites, and generally feel like a first class citizen of the Index network.

<aside> 🎪 Other than the above, every Node is independently owned and has no obligations, financial or otherwise, to any of the other Nodes, nor the network at large.

Nodes can choose to develop their own brand identity, or piggy-back on the Index brand (which we’ll carefully work on together).

What makes Index Nodes unique?

Nodes can be any space that provides a needed service to its local creative community. It can be a co-working space, an event space, a cinema, a bathhouse, a hotel, a retreat center, a community garden, or all of the above. As long as the core values mentioned above are given shape in some form, any space could become or apply to become a Node.
